解决os.path.isdir() 判断文件夹却返回false的问题


Posted in Python onNovember 29, 2019

今天使用os.path.isdir()判断是否是文件夹的时候发现一个问题:

lst = os.listdir(path)
    for i in lst:
      if os.path.isdir(i)

遍历到path下面的一个子文件夹时,os.path.isdir()却返回 false。

但如果使用如下处理,就能正常处理,返回true.

lst = os.listdir(path)

    for i in lst:
      i = os.path.join(path, i)  #=================〉这一行很必要
      if os.path.isdir(i):

以上这篇解决os.path.isdir() 判断文件夹却返回false的问题就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python实现登录人人网并抓取新鲜事的方法
May 11 Python
详解Python如何获取列表(List)的中位数
Aug 12 Python
浅谈python函数之作用域(python3.5)
Oct 27 Python
Python机器学习算法之k均值聚类(k-means)
Feb 23 Python
[原创]Python入门教程4. 元组基本操作
Oct 31 Python
Pandas读写CSV文件的方法示例
Mar 27 Python
使用python3调用wxpy模块监控linux日志并定时发送消息给群组或好友
Jun 05 Python
Python如何用filter函数筛选数据
Mar 05 Python
Tensorflow实现将标签变为one-hot形式
May 22 Python
Pytorch损失函数nn.NLLLoss2d()用法说明
Jul 07 Python
详解Django ORM引发的数据库N+1性能问题
Oct 12 Python
浅谈Python __init__.py的作用
Oct 28 Python
windows环境中利用celery实现简单任务队列过程解析
Nov 29 #Python
基于Python中isfile函数和isdir函数使用详解
Nov 29 #Python
python os.path.isfile 的使用误区详解
Nov 29 #Python
python实现矩阵和array数组之间的转换
Nov 29 #Python
Python3 使用map()批量的转换数据类型,如str转float的实现
Nov 29 #Python
python os.path.isfile()因参数问题判断错误的解决
Nov 29 #Python
python bluetooth蓝牙信息获取蓝牙设备类型的方法
Nov 29 #Python
You might like
php中OR与|| AND与&&的区别总结
2013/10/26 PHP
分享自定义的几个PHP功能函数
2015/04/15 PHP
php实现微信支付之企业付款
2018/05/30 PHP
PHP+mysql实现的三级联动菜单功能示例
2019/02/15 PHP
thinkphp3.2同时连接两个数据库的简单方法
2019/08/13 PHP
JavaScript基础语法让人疑惑的地方小结
2012/05/23 Javascript
JS验证控制输入中英文字节长度(input、textarea等)具体实例
2013/06/21 Javascript
加载远程图片时,经常因为缓存而得不到更新的解决方法(分享)
2013/06/26 Javascript
uploadify在Firefox下丢失session问题的解决方法
2013/08/07 Javascript
js实现省市联动效果的简单实例
2014/02/10 Javascript
JavaScript设计模式之外观模式介绍
2014/12/28 Javascript
jQuery固定元素插件scrolltofixed使用指南
2015/04/21 Javascript
ECMAScript6中Set/WeakSet详解
2015/06/12 Javascript
JavaScript性能优化之小知识总结
2015/11/20 Javascript
AngularJS 作用域详解及示例代码
2016/08/17 Javascript
Vue.js表单控件实践
2016/10/27 Javascript
js前端导出Excel的方法
2017/11/01 Javascript
基于vue2实现上拉加载功能
2017/11/28 Javascript
JS实现根据详细地址获取经纬度功能示例
2019/04/16 Javascript
react-native滑动吸顶效果的实现过程
2019/06/03 Javascript
教你搭建按需加载的Vue组件库(小结)
2019/07/29 Javascript
webpack + vue 打包生成公共配置文件(域名) 方便动态修改
2019/08/29 Javascript
微信小程序用canvas画图并分享
2020/03/09 Javascript
maptalks+three.js+vue webpack实现二维地图上贴三维模型操作
2020/08/10 Javascript
[54:10]Spirit vs NB Supermajor小组赛 A组败者组决赛 BO3 第一场 6.2
2018/06/03 DOTA
Python给你的头像加上圣诞帽
2018/01/04 Python
Python把csv数据写入list和字典类型的变量脚本方法
2018/06/15 Python
idea创建springMVC框架和配置小文件的教程图解
2018/09/18 Python
40个你可能不知道的Python技巧附代码
2020/01/29 Python
Born鞋子官网:Born Shoes
2017/04/06 全球购物
jurlique茱莉蔻英国官网:澳洲天然护肤品
2018/08/03 全球购物
自然健康的概念:Natural Healthy Concepts
2020/01/26 全球购物
加拿大探亲邀请信
2014/01/28 职场文书
会计专业自我评价
2014/02/12 职场文书
高中课程设置方案
2014/05/28 职场文书
彻底解决MySQL使用中文乱码的方法
2022/01/22 MySQL